Soonr, a leading provider of Secure Online File Sharing and Collaboration services for business, today announced that Soonr Workplace is immediately available on the Upware™ marketplace from Comcast Business.
The Upware™ marketplace is a suite of cloud-based business solutions that can be purchased through one easy-to-use web portal. It contains a carefully selected list of third-party, cloud-based business applications from industry-leading companies in key categories such as data backup, data security, document collaboration and web collaboration. Upware is designed to meet the needs of small and medium businesses looking to use cloud-based solutions to simplify their IT systems, control costs and increase productivity.

In a recent report by Enterprise Strategy Group, Soonr Workplace was ranked No. 1 in online file sharing and collaboration and mobile ease-of-use for business. Built on a carrier-grade infrastructure, Soonr empowers more than 140,000 businesses to securely store, share, access, edit, sync and collaborate on business-critical files. Dedicated to security and reliability, Soonr has achieved 99.9+ percent availability since 2006, and operates its privately owned and operated geo-redundant regional datacenters with 256-bit encryption, HIPAA and SSAE 16 compliance.
Pricing, Support and Availability
Soonr Workplace Pro Plan
$8 / User / Month or $80 / User / Year (Minimum 3 Users)
Includes 1000 GB and 3 Connections
Soonr Workplace Enterprise Plan
$15 / User / Month or $150 / User / Year (Minimum 3 Users)
Includes 1000 GB and 5 Connections
About Comcast Business Services
Comcast Business Services, a unit of Comcast Cable, provides advanced communication solutions to help organizations of all sizes meet their business objectives. Through a modern, advanced network that is backed by 24/7 technical support, Comcast delivers Business Class Internet, TV and Voice services for cost-effective, simplified communications management.
Launched in 2011, the Comcast Business Class Ethernet suite offers high-performance point-to-point and multi-point Metro Ethernet services with the capacity to deliver cloud computing, software-as-a-service, business continuity/disaster recovery and other bandwidth-intensive applications. Comcast Metro Ethernet services are significantly faster than standard T1 lines and other legacy technologies, providing scalable bandwidth from 1 Mbps up to 10 Gigabits-per-second (Gbps) in more than 20 major US markets.
